🚀 Researchers Develop Advanced Model To Predict Human Behavior

According to Cointelegraph, a team of researchers from several leading universities has developed a new computational model capable of predicting and simulating human behavior with high accuracy. The model, named Centaur, aims to accelerate scientific discovery, model building, and experimental piloting by simulating human behavior across various domains. This development is detailed in a research paper published on October 28. The model was trained on a dataset called Psych101, which includes data from 160 psychological experiments involving 60,092 participants who made over 10 million choices. The researchers assert that while previous attempts have been made to create such comprehensive models, none have fully captured the human mind's complexity until now. Centaur's ability to simulate and predict human behavior in any domain sets it apart from existing domain-specific computational models. Lead researcher Marcel Binz shared that Centaur was fine-tuned using Meta’s AI-based language model, Llama 3.1 70B, resulting in a model that outperforms existing cognitive models in predicting the behavior of unseen participants. Cognitive models aim to replicate human mental processes, including perception, reasoning, and memory. Binz noted that Centaur's internal representations became more aligned with human neural activity after fine-tuning, despite not being explicitly trained for this purpose. The research paper highlights Centaur's capabilities to operate in real-time, exhibit rational adaptive behavior, and learn from its environment. Binz believes that Centaur represents the first viable candidate for a unified model of human cognition, as envisioned by renowned cognitive scientist Alan Newell. Newell, who specialized in computer science and cognitive psychology, worked for the RAND Corporation, a global policy think tank and research institute.

🚀 Ripple Advances Institutional Finance Strategy with New Compliance Tools

According to PANews, Ripple has announced an acceleration of its institutional finance strategy, unveiling a series of compliance and credit tools. This development comes as the company prepares to launch a native lending protocol later this year. Currently, three compliance features—credentials, deep freeze, and simulation—are operational. Credentials are linked to decentralized identity identifiers, enabling issuers to verify user attributes. The deep freeze feature can prevent sanctioned accounts from transferring funds, while the simulation tool allows developers to test transactions without recording them, thereby expanding the compliance toolkit.

The forthcoming lending protocol will introduce pooled lending and underwritten credit, offering institutions low-cost compliant loans and providing small investors with earning opportunities. Additionally, the XRPL community plans to develop zero-knowledge proofs, with confidential multi-purpose tokens expected to launch in early 2026. These tokens will enable collateral management without disclosing sensitive data.

Ripple's roadmap indicates a vision to establish XRPL as a leading blockchain for institutional finance. The success of this initiative will depend on balancing regulatory compliance with security enhancements.

🚀 Siemens Anticipates Continued Growth in AI-Driven Industrial Software

Siemens projects sustained growth in the application of artificial intelligence within industrial software, driven by increasing demand for data centers and automation. Bloomberg posted on X that CEO Roland Busch expressed optimism about AI's potential to enhance simulation and physics-based software. Busch highlighted the transformative impact of AI technologies on Siemens' operations, suggesting that these advancements will continue to propel the company's business forward. The integration of AI is expected to enrich the capabilities of Siemens' software offerings, aligning with the broader trend of digital transformation in the industrial sector.

🚀 Bank of England Plans Simulation to Assess AI's Economic Impact

The Bank of England is preparing to conduct a simulation to evaluate the potential economic and financial impacts of artificial intelligence technology. According to Jin10, concerns are rising that AI could lead to significant job losses and negatively affect numerous businesses. The central bank aims to understand how these changes might influence the broader economy and financial systems. This initiative reflects growing apprehension about AI's transformative effects on employment and industry sectors.
